The role of the Implementation Manager is client-focused and reports to the Director of Project Implementation. The Implementation Manager is responsible for delivering Warehouse Management System (WMS) implementation projects of all sizes and complexity for various warehouse clients worldwide.

In partnership with Project Manager, Scrum Master and the Director of Project Implementation, the Implementation Manager will work with an Agile delivery team to deliver solutions to the clients.

Role and Responsibilities

  • Leading requirement discovery
  • Facilitating solutions design
  • Training clients
  • Customer liaison in fielding concerns, strategizing on solution, and setting expectations or limitations
  • Adding detail to the Product Backlog items, so the Technical Associates can deliver with confidence
  • Providing oversight of the technical items delivered by the Technical Associates
  • Testing of technical solutions in the customer environment
  • Accountability for the success of client Go Live either on-site or remotely
  • Assigning tasks and providing training to the Technical Associates
  • Acting as a client consultant to advise clients in best practices and efficiencies
  • Assisting the Director and other departments with Process Improvement initiatives
  • Ensuring all artifacts are stored in the DevOps project for the client
  • Potentially acting as the Product Owner for a specific Client Delivery Team
  • Potential working toward specializing in work for customers from a specific industry

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
